Long-term treatment with vancomycin in severely ill patients has been the scenario for the emergence of vancomycin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us (VRSA). 1 Vancomycin-intermediate S aureus (VISA) and the first VRSA strain were isolated in this classic setting. 1 , 2 Recently, however, Cynthia Whitener and colleagues 3 reported that the second VRSA strain to be discovered was isolated from a patient in Pennsylvania, USA, who had not been exposed to vancomycin for 5 years.
